Transaction b72c7feee0bec17c318855e2d70f8ce7112b9cb35b2feacdae12d70be212123d

12 Input
1 Outputs
  • b72c7feee0bec17c318855e2d70f8ce7112b9cb35b2feacdae12d70be212123d:0
  • value  8080053
    address  3M89TUXn5NSFe61BWBofpd4ZpKVCimDk5p